About Faire
Faire is an online wholesale marketplace built on the belief that the future is local β independent retailers around the globe are doing more revenue than Walmart and Amazon combined, but individually, they are small compared to these massive entities. At Faire, we're using the power of tech, data, and machine learning to connect this thriving community of entrepreneurs across the globe. Picture your favorite boutique in town β we help them discover the best products from around the world to sell in their stores. With the right tools and insights, we believe that we can level the playing field so that small businesses everywhere can compete with these big box and e-commerce giants.
By supporting the growth of independent businesses, Faire is driving positive economic impact in local communities, globally. Weβre looking for smart, resourceful and passionate people to join us as we power the shop local movement. If you believe in community, come join ours.
About the Role:
The Discovery Search team (Search FX) sits at the intersection of search, evaluation, and personalization shaping how retailers find the products they love. Our mission is to build the most intuitive, intelligent, and delightful discovery experience in wholesale: one that feels less like a search engine and more like a trusted merchant with an encyclopedic knowledge of what's in stock and what will sell.
As a Staff Engineer on the Search FX team, you will be a primary technical architect for our retailer-facing search surfaces. You will own the technical roadmap for search, recommendations, and Gen-AI experiences that drive a meaningful share of marketplace engagement. You will bridge the gap between high-scale infrastructure and world-class UX, helping unify retrieval, ranking, and personalization into a cohesive, high-performance system.
Youβre excited about this role because...
β’ You will own the technical vision: Define the end-to-end architecture for Faire's search and discovery experience, ensuring it is fast, relevant, and deeply personalized.
β’ Youβll build at the AI frontier: Integrate LLM-powered capabilities, such as natural language search and intelligent query understanding, directly into the product.
β’ Youβll solve complex scale problems: Help build high-scale, low-latency systems that navigate millions of products while meeting strict industry latency benchmarks.
β’ Youβll drive cross-functional impact: Partner closely with Data Science, Product, and Design to iterate on ranking models and UX components.
β’ Youβll be a mentor and leader: Foster a culture of engineering excellence and ownership, upskilling the team on technical expertise and decision-making.
What You'll Do:
β’ Architect Next-Gen Search: Lead the design of composable grids, intent-aware routing, and orchestration layers that unify retrieval and ranking.
β’ Modernize Query Understanding: Leverage LLMs to consolidate the QU stack, improving accuracy for long-tail queries and edge cases.
β’ Optimize Performance: Drive initiatives to increase retrieval candidates (e.g., 10x growth) while maintaining stable search latency.
β’ Launch AI-Driven Features: Develop systems like "Search Missions" that use offline pipelines and LLMs to recover failed search sessions through expanded queries.
β’ Bridge AI and UX: Work with client engineers on SDUI and React Server Components to improve performance and developer velocity for dynamic search layouts.
β’ System Ownership: Take accountability for the reliability and observability of the search funnel, from query planner refactors to real-time retrieval monitoring.
Qualifications:
β’ Experience: 7+ years of professional software engineering experience, with 3+ years as a technical leader driving complex, cross-team projects.
β’ Product Sensibility: A strong user-first mindset and the ability to translate ambiguous business problems into clear technical direction.
β’ AI/ML Familiarity: Experience partnering with Data Science to deploy and leverage machine learning and gen-AI systems in search experiences across ranking and retrieval.
β’ Domain Expertise: knowledge of search/query processing, including traditional, semantic, and hybrid frameworks (e.g., Elasticsearch, Lucene).
β’ Technical Stack: Strong programming skills in Kotlin or Java, with experience in high-performance backend systems, Protocol Buffers, and MySQL.
β’ Strategic Leadership: Demonstrated ability to contribute to team strategy without supervision and influence the broader organizational roadmap.
Technologies We Use and Teach:
β’ Backend: Kotlin, Java 16, Hibernate, Guice, Jersey
β’ Search/Data: Elasticsearch, FAISS, Redis, DynamoDB
β’ Communication: Protocol Buffers, HTTP, JSON
β’ Infrastructure: AWS, Kubernetes, Buildkite, Datadog
Salary Range:
San Francisco: the pay range for this role is $231,000 - $318,000 per year.
This role will also be eligible for equity and benefits. Actual base pay will be determined based on permissible factors such as transferable skills, work experience, market demands, and primary work location. The base pay range provided is subject to change and may be modified in the future.
Hybrid Faire employees currently go into the office 3 days per week on Tuesdays, Thursdays, and a third flex day of their choosing (Monday, Wednesday, or Friday). Additionally, hybrid in-office roles will have the flexibility to work remotely up to 4 weeks per year. Specific Workplace and Information Technology positions may require onsite attendance 5 days per week as will be indicated in the job posting.
Why youβll love working at Faire
β’ We are entrepreneurs: Faire is being built for entrepreneurs, by entrepreneurs. We believe entrepreneurship is a calling and our mission is to empower entrepreneurs to chase their dreams. Every member of our team is taking part in the founding process.
β’ We are using technology and data to level the playing field: We are leveraging the power of product innovation and machine learning to connect brands and boutiques from all over the world, building a growing community of more than 350,000 small business owners.
β’ We build products our customers love: Everything we do is ultimately in the service of helping our customers grow their business because our goal is to grow the pie - not steal a piece from it. Running a small business is hard work, but using Faire makes it easy.
β’ We are curious and resourceful: Inquisitive by default, we explore every possibility, test every assumption, and develop creative solutions to the challenges at hand. We lead with curiosity and data in our decision making, and reason from a first principles mentality.
Faire was founded in 2017 by a team of early product and engineering leads from Square. Weβre backed by some of the top investors in retail and tech including: Y Combinator, Lightspeed Venture Partners, Forerunner Ventures, Khosla Ventures, Sequoia Capital, Founders Fund, and DST Global. We have headquarters in San Francisco and Kitchener-Waterloo, and a global employee presence across offices in Toronto, London, and New York. To learn more about Faire and our customers, you can read more on our blog.
Faire provides equal employment opportunities (EEO) to all employees and applicants for employment without regard to race, color, religion, sex, national origin, age, disability, genetics, sexual orientation, gender identity or gender expression.
Faire is committed to providing access, equal opportunity and reasonable accommodation for individuals with disabilities in employment, its services, programs, and activities. Accommodations are available throughout the recruitment process and applicants with a disability may request to be accommodated throughout the recruitment process. We will work with all applicants to accommodate their individual accessibility needs. To request reasonable accommodation, please fill out our Accommodation Request Form ([Upgrade to PRO to see link]
Privacy
For information about the type of personal data Faire collects from applicants, as well as your choices regarding the data collected about you, please visit Faireβs Privacy Notice ([Upgrade to PRO to see link]